XL 2013 MACRO TRIE CLIENT SUR ONGLETS

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

olivier972

XLDnaute Occasionnel
Bonjour,
je vous joint un fichier excel ou j ai en colonne C une liste de client.
je souhaiterais regrouper les mêmes clients sur un même onglet avec le calcul de poids et nombre de colis en automatique.
Comme il s'agit d'un fichier générer d'une extraction mensuel d'un autre programme il faudrait la macro hors du fichier.
A noter que le nom du fichier changera chaque mois et qu'il peux y avoir d'autres noms de clients d'un moi à l'autre.
Je vous remercie tous de votre aide par avance.
Olivier
 

Pièces jointes

Bonjour,
Voici en pièce jointe le fichier macro pour le traitement souhaité.
Dialogue pour sélection et ouverture du fichier mensuel, tri des clients par onglet au nom du client avec insertion totaux et fermeture du fichier macro en fin de procédure. J'ai mis des commentaires dans le code notamment attention que le nom d'un onglet ne peut comporter de caractères spéciaux tels que / comme il y a un exemple dans le fichier envoyé. Celui-ci est pris en compte et remplacé par un espace dans la macro. Mais il ne m'est pas possible de prévoir s'il peut y en avoir d'autres.
En espérant que cela vous aidera.
 

Pièces jointes

Bonjour Lupin,
Merci de ton aide, cela ne fonctionne pas.
Je te joint le fichier de base pour la facturation de septembre pour exemple et le résultat que cela donne avec ta macro.
pj fichier de base a travailler
fichier resultat
print ecran bug

Merci

Cdlt
 

Pièces jointes

-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
3
Affichages
489
Retour